Over the 12 months ending 2026-09-10, 5 recorded sales closed at a median of $230,000, $192 per square foot, a median 2 days on market, sellers accepting 100% of original asking (-6% versus the prior year). At the median price and Duval County's FY2025-26 rate of 17.86 mills, annual property tax runs about $4,110 ($3,370 with the full homestead exemption).

A condition-driven market that moves fast

With homes built across a narrow span and a median size around 1,355 square feet, this is a community of similar footprints. That uniformity means the spread in sale prices comes down to renovations, systems, and finish level rather than dramatically different floor plans. A well-updated home and a tired one here can be the same size and still sell for very different numbers.

Just under 60% of homes are homestead-occupied, which points to a base of long-term owners rather than a churn of investors. The median five-and-a-half day time on market shows demand is present even as prices have eased 8.2% over the past year. Over a longer horizon, values are up 290% since 2012 — useful context, not a forecast, and not a promise of what comes next.
